We're fired up with today's previews, so lets get to them now -

Berserk - Awesome reprint is awesome - great combat trick for pushing lethal damage through.  Everyone should fear a single untapped forest.

Dragonlair Spider - Reprint - a lot of players like this but this never really floated our boat.

Garbage Fire - What's that smell?  It's the Card from yesterday's story art.  Fun card.

Grenzo, Havoc Raiser - He'll leave the burning to the arsonist-loving minions while he pillages. Ain't too bad with some decent conditional abilities for 'goad', and a take on that 'Daxos of Meletis' ability.


Illusionary Informant - very sneaky bird will sneak a peek a what is being drafted.

Skyline Despot - Damn powerful card - delivers you the crown and the chance to puke dragon tokens to help keep that crown.

Spire Phantasm - another injection of fun during draft that may net you a card draw.


Volatile Chimera - cool card but perhaps too random for our tastes.

Righto!  Let's look at the official preview from yesterday's Magic Story, penned by one of our fav staffers Alison Luhrs, titled 'Tyrant' - 

Kaya, Ghost Assassin, 2WB
Planeswalker - Kaya, Mythic Rare

[0]: Exile Kaya, Ghost Assassin or up to one target creature. Return that card to the battlefield under its owner's control at the beginning of your next upkeep. You lose 2 life.
[-1]: Each opponent loses 2 life and you gain 2 life.
[-2]: Each opponent discards a card and you draw a card.
[5]

As suspected from last week's story when the character was first introduced, this Planeswalker is Orzhov colours of Black and White.  CMC of 4 mana for a 'Walker with 5 loyalty ain't bad at all, but how is the rest of the card?

First ability at zero blinks Kaya and a target critter.  If you target a creature with Kaya's zero ability, you choose on resolution whether to exile that creature or Kaya.  The minus one ability is similar to a Syphon Soul effect while the minus two ability is similar to a Syphon Mind ability.

For those loving the vorthos / flavour of the card, there is some very cool cleverness WotC has provided - there is no plus ability as Kaya the assassin is loyal to none, while the the other two abilities may be akin to signing (in blood) a contract with her.
